**What is company lead generation?**
Company lead generation is the process of attracting and converting potential customers into leads – individuals who have shown interest in a company’s products or services. These leads are essential for sales teams to nurture and eventually convert into paying customers. Lead generation involves leveraging various marketing tactics and channels to capture the attention of prospective customers and initiate a relationship with them.

**Strategies for company lead generation**
1. **Content Marketing:** Content marketing is a powerful tool for lead generation. By creating informative and engaging content that addresses the pain points of your target audience, you can attract prospects to your website and establish your company as a trusted authority in your industry. Content formats such as blog posts, whitepapers, e-books, and videos can all be used to capture leads and move them through the sales funnel.
2. **Social Media Marketing:** Social media platforms offer a wealth of opportunities for lead generation. By actively engaging with your audience on platforms like Facebook, LinkedIn, Instagram, and Twitter, you can drive traffic to your website, generate leads, and promote your products or services. Social media advertising, in particular, can help target specific demographics and reach a wider audience.
3. **Search Engine Optimization (SEO):** Optimizing your website for search engines is essential for attracting organic traffic and generating leads. By incorporating relevant keywords, creating high-quality content, and building backlinks, you can improve your website’s visibility in search engine results pages (SERPs) and attract more qualified leads. Additionally, local SEO tactics can help increase your company’s visibility in local searches and connect you with potential customers in your area.
4. **Email Marketing:** Email marketing remains a highly effective lead generation strategy. By building a mailing list of interested prospects and sending targeted email campaigns, you can nurture leads, build relationships, and drive conversions. Personalizing your emails, segmenting your audience, and providing valuable content can all help increase engagement and ultimately lead to more sales.
5. **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ising:** PPC advertising allows companies to drive targeted traffic to their website through paid ads. By bidding on relevant keywords and creating compelling ad copy, you can reach prospects who are actively searching for your products or services. Platforms like Google Ads and Facebook Ads offer robust targeting options that can help you maximize your ROI and generate high-quality leads.
**Best Practices for Company Lead Generation**
1. **Define Your Target Audience:** Before implementing any lead generation strategy, it’s essential to clearly define your target audience. Understanding the demographics, interests, and behaviors of your ideal customers will help you create more targeted and effective marketing campaigns.
2. **Utilize Multiple Channels:** Don’t rely on just one lead generation channel. Instead, diversify your efforts across multiple channels to maximize your reach and increase your chances of attracting leads. Experiment with different tactics to see what works best for your company.
3. **Track and Analyze Your Results:** Monitoring the performance of your lead generation efforts is critical for optimizing your strategies and maximizing your ROI. Use tools like Google Analytics, CRM software, and marketing automation platforms to track key metrics, identify trends, and make data-driven decisions.
4. **Provide Value:** When creating content or engaging with prospects, focus on providing value rather than just promoting your products or services. By addressing your audience’s needs and offering solutions to their problems, you can build trust and establish credibility with potential leads.
5. **Stay Consistent:** Lead generation is an ongoing process that requires constant attention and effort. Stay consistent with your marketing efforts, test different strategies, and adjust your approach based on the feedback you receive from your audience.
